
I'm trying to figure out how we can manage pricing more easily in AX 2012. Currently we have to set/import everything manually. Our MSRP is in CAD, and then we convert it to EUR manually on a spreadsheet and so on for all other currencies etc. What I would like to do is first setup regular imports of all currencies we use from either XE.com or Bloomberg which I know how to do. I would like then only import the USD MSRP price to AX and then get all other currency prices filled-in automatically by using the imported exchange rates. What would be the best way to get this done?

It is possible to have automatic price conversions based on a given exchange rate type.
You can find parameters on the Accounts Receivable parameters form (tab Prices). E.g. you can specify the exchange rate type to use for price conversions. You can also apply rounding. The setup is called "Smart rounding". Documentation is available here: technet.microsoft.com/.../hh242522.aspx
